WebAnti-aromaticity for molecules with more than 8 pi electrons is known, but very unusual. Is pentalene dianion aromatic? The pentalene dianion has 10 electrons and is therefore aromatic; it is a stable molecule. Which compound is antiaromatic? Examples of antiaromatic compounds are pentalene (A), biphenylene (B), cyclopentadienyl cation (C). Web3 feb. 2011 · All carbon atoms in naphthalene, anthracene, and phenanthrene are sp2 hybridized. All atoms in the rings, as well as those directly attached to the rings, are coplanar.
